First off, X 4 should be faster even without acceleration thanks to the ShadowFB layer. The fbdev driver can't provide acceleration as it's just a generic driver for framebuffer devices. The matrox driver OTOH is well accelerated, even on top of the framebuffer device. There may be some endianness etc. bugs though.
